10.2.2 Overview of diagnostic events
Status
signal/
Diagnostic
event
Diagnostic
behavior
EventCode Event text Cause Remedial measure
S140 Warning 0x180F Sensor signal outside
of permitted ranges
Overpressure or low pressure
present
Operate device in the specified measuring
range.
S140 Warning 0x180F Sensor signal outside
of permitted ranges
Sensor defective Replace device.
F270
1) 2)
Fault 0x1800 Overpressure/low
pressure
Overpressure or low pressure
present
• Check the process pressure.
• Check the sensor range.
• Restart device.
F270
1) 2)
Fault 0x1800 Defect in electronics/
sensor
Defect in electronics/sensor Replace device.
C431
3)
Warning 0x1805 Invalid position
adjustment (Current
output)
The adjustment performed would
cause the sensor nominal range to
be exceeded or undershot.
Position adjustment + parameter of the
current output must be within the sensor
nominal range
• Check position adjustment (see Zero
point configuration (ZRO) parameter)
• Check measuring range (see Value for
20 mA (STU) and Value for 4 mA
(STL) parameters)
C432 Warning 0x1806 Invalid position
adjustment (Switching
output)
The adjustment performed leads to
switch points being outside the
sensor nominal range.
Position adjustment + parameter of the
hysteresis and window function must be
within the sensor nominal range
• Check position adjustment (see Zero
point configuration (ZRO) parameter)
• Check the switch point, switchback
point for hysteresis and window
function
F437 Fault 0x1810 Incompatible
configuration
Invalid device configuration • Restart device.
• Reset device.
• Replace device.
C485 Warning 0x8C01
4)
Simulation active During simulation of the switch
output or current output, the device
issues a warning message.
Switch off simulation.
S510 Fault 0x1802 Turn down violated A change in the span results in a
violation of the turn down (max. TD
5:1)
Values for adjustment (lower range
value and upper range value) are
too close together
• Operate device in the specified
measuring range.
• Check the measuring range.
S803 Fault 0x1804 Current loop Impedance of load resistance at
analog output is too high
• Check the cabling and load at the
current output.
• If the current output is not required,
switch it off via the configuration.
S803 Fault 0x1804 Current output not
connected
Current output not connected • Connect current output with load.
• If the current output is not required,
switch it off via the configuration.
F804 Fault - Overload at switch
output
Load current too high Increase load resistance at switch output
F804 Fault - Overload at switch
output
Switch output defective • Check output circuit.
• Replace device.
